| 186 | /*!
|
---|
| 187 | \class QDirModel
|
---|
[846] | 188 | \obsolete
|
---|
[2] | 189 | \brief The QDirModel class provides a data model for the local filesystem.
|
---|
| 190 |
|
---|
| 191 | \ingroup model-view
|
---|
| 192 |
|
---|
[846] | 193 | The usage of QDirModel is not recommended anymore. The
|
---|
[561] | 194 | QFileSystemModel class is a more performant alternative.
|
---|
| 195 |
|
---|
[2] | 196 | This class provides access to the local filesystem, providing functions
|
---|
| 197 | for renaming and removing files and directories, and for creating new
|
---|
| 198 | directories. In the simplest case, it can be used with a suitable display
|
---|
| 199 | widget as part of a browser or filer.
|
---|
| 200 |
|
---|
| 201 | QDirModel keeps a cache with file information. The cache needs to be
|
---|
| 202 | updated with refresh().
|
---|
| 203 |
|
---|
| 204 | QDirModel can be accessed using the standard interface provided by
|
---|
| 205 | QAbstractItemModel, but it also provides some convenience functions
|
---|
| 206 | that are specific to a directory model. The fileInfo() and isDir()
|
---|
| 207 | functions provide information about the underlying files and directories
|
---|
| 208 | related to items in the model.
|
---|
| 209 |
|
---|
| 210 | Directories can be created and removed using mkdir(), rmdir(), and the
|
---|
| 211 | model will be automatically updated to take the changes into account.
|
---|
| 212 |
|
---|
| 213 | \note QDirModel requires an instance of a GUI application.
|
---|
| 214 |
|
---|
[561] | 215 | \sa nameFilters(), setFilter(), filter(), QListView, QTreeView, QFileSystemModel,
|
---|
[2] | 216 | {Dir View Example}, {Model Classes}
|
---|
| 217 | */
